Connecting the Dots: Teamwork Between Web Designers & Developers

In today's dynamic digital landscape, effective websites require a seamless blend of creativity and functionality. This is where the collaboration between web designers and software developers comes into play. While web designers focus on the visual appeal and user experience, software developers bring the technical expertise to build robust and interactive applications.

A strong relationship between these two professions is crucial for producing exceptional online experiences. Effective communication, shared goals, and a mutual understanding of each other's roles are the cornerstones of this partnership. By closing the gap between design and development, teams can realize their full potential and craft websites that are both visually stunning and technically sound.
